The Power of AI: Custom Solutions for Law Firms

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ping the legal research landscape. Custom AI solutions enable firms to analyze vast amounts of case history and surface relevant precedents with unprecedented accuracy. Unlike standard SaaS solutions, custom-built AI platforms can be tailored to address specific needs of South African law firms, such as local legal databases and bilingual search capabilities.

Take for instance a large firm in Johannesburg that implemented a custom AI platform. They reported a 50% reduction in research time, allowing their legal professionals to dedicate more time to client interaction and case strategy. This efficiency not only boosts productivity but also enhances client satisfaction.

By investing in AI, firms can gain a competitive edge, streamline their operations, and significantly improve their bottom line. With AI, the daunting task of sifting through hundreds of cases becomes manageable, allowing lawyers to focus on delivering high-quality legal services.

Building a Custom AI Case Intelligence Platform

Creating a custom AI platform starts with a thorough evaluation of your firm's specific needs. Begin by identifying the most time-consuming aspects of your current research process. Engage with your legal team to understand their workflow and pinpoint areas where AI can make a difference.

Key features to look for include seamless integration with existing systems, intuitive user interfaces, and robust data analytics capabilities. Integration is crucial to ensure that the AI tool complements your current systems, such as your case management software.

User experience is paramount. The platform should be user-friendly, allowing legal professionals of all tech proficiencies to navigate it easily. By prioritizing these elements, you can build a tool that not only meets but exceeds your firm's expectations.

Data Management: Organizing Your Firm's Case History

Effective data management is the cornerstone of successful AI implementation. Start by digitizing all case files and documents. This not only facilitates easier access but also enhances the efficiency of AI tools in processing and retrieving relevant information.

Security is a critical concern. Ensure compliance with South African laws, such as POPIA, to protect sensitive client data. Implement robust encryption methods and access controls to safeguard your data.

Utilize metadata to improve searchability within your AI platform. By tagging documents with relevant metadata, you enhance the tool's ability to quickly locate needed information, thus streamlining the research process.

Leveraging Winning Strategies and Precedents

AI can identify patterns and strategies from historical data that have led to successful case outcomes. By analyzing these patterns, your firm can develop more effective legal strategies tailored to specific case types.

For example, an AI tool might reveal that certain arguments consistently win in employment law cases in Gauteng. Leveraging such insights allows your team to refine their approach and increase their success rate.

Continuously update your AI model with new case data to ensure it remains relevant and effective. Regular updates allow the tool to adapt to evolving legal trends and maintain its predictive accuracy.

How much does it cost to implement a custom AI legal research platform?
The cost of implementing a custom AI platform varies, but it generally involves initial development fees, integration costs, and ongoing maintenance expenses. For South African firms, costs could range from ZAR 500,000 to several million, depending on the platform's complexity and features.

How can law firms ensure data security when using AI?
Ensuring data security involves compliance with the Protection of Personal Information Act (POPIA), implementing robust encryption methods, and establishing strict access controls. Regular security audits and staff training on data protection best practices are also essential in maintaining data integrity.
